Automatic transmission lag on takeoff?
 
Ok, so I've had my 2013 GT for a few days now and I notice there's a lag in standard drive when I take off. I understand this is a pretty common annoyance and have heard it can be fixed with a different tune. Can someone point me in the direction to get this done? I don't feel confident enough to do it myself, so I'll be taking it someplace.

A new tune can be acquired by simply purchasing a handheld tuner from a forum vendor (they make the tune and load onto the handheld tuner) and mailed to you. You can upload to your car by yourself. On my 99 I just plugged it in to the car's OBD2 port and followed the directions. I think its still very similar on the newer cars.

You can also find a local shop and have it dyno tuned instead.

I had that lag in my '14 gt. felt more like throttle response issue. theres a box that plugs into the throttle pedal and takes that all away, and its adjustable. Its from JMS called a "pedalmax" works perfectly on mine, quicker throttle response, gas mileage suffers a bit, but not bad. I don't think you're feeling the trans, most likely throttle lag
